What you'll be doing
* This is a temporary full-time position, to gain a well-trained and educated dental assistant providing dental care within the limits of their Education whilst working towards competency in Dental Assisting under the direction and supervision of Education Coordinators.
* The Dental Assistant Trainee will undertake educational and clinical experience within all aspects of Dentistry including but not limited to Chairside Assisting, Management of Infection Control, Instrument Preparation, Dental Charting, Sterilisation and Patient Care.
